+package acme
+
+import "time"
+
+// ChallengeProvider enables implementing a custom challenge
+// provider. Present presents the solution to a challenge available to
+// be solved. CleanUp will be called by the challenge if Present ends
+// in a non-error state.
+type ChallengeProvider interface {
+ Present(domain, token, keyAuth string) error
+ CleanUp(domain, token, keyAuth string) error
+}
+
+// ChallengeProviderTimeout allows for implementing a
+// ChallengeProvider where an unusually long timeout is required when
+// waiting for an ACME challenge to be satisfied, such as when
+// checking for DNS record progagation. If an implementor of a
+// ChallengeProvider provides a Timeout method, then the return values
+// of the Timeout method will be used when appropriate by the acme
+// package. The interval value is the time between checks.
+//
+// The default values used for timeout and interval are 60 seconds and
+// 2 seconds respectively. These are used when no Timeout method is
+// defined for the ChallengeProvider.
+type ChallengeProviderTimeout interface {
+ ChallengeProvider
+ Timeout() (timeout, interval time.Duration)
+}
